Creating a safe and hygienic kitchen at home is essential to safeguard the well-being of your loved ones. Follow these practical tips to maintain optimal food safety in your home:

  1. Smart Grocery Shopping:
    • Check product labels for freshness and expiration dates.
    • Inspect packaging for any signs of damage or compromise.
  2. Proper Food Storage:

    • Store raw meats on the lowest shelf to prevent cross-contamination.
  3. Mindful Thawing:
    • Thaw frozen foods in the refrigerator, under cold running water, or in the microwave.
    • Avoid thawing at room temperature to prevent bacterial growth.
  4. Cooking Techniques:
    • Invest in a reliable food thermometer to ensure that meats are cooked to a safe internal temperature.
    • Embrace cooking methods like steaming, baking, and grilling to retain nutritional value.
  5. Leftover Management:
    • Refrigerate leftovers promptly, within two hours of cooking.
    • Consume leftovers within 3-4 days or freeze for longer storage.
  6. Kitchen Cleanliness:
    • Establish a routine for cleaning kitchen surfaces, cutting boards, and utensils.
    • Regularly clean appliances such as blenders, food processors, and can openers.
  7. Family Education:
    • Educate family members on the importance of food safety practices.
    • Encourage children to wash their hands before meals and snacks.
  8. Waste Management:
    • Dispose of food waste promptly to prevent the attraction of pests.
    • Compost suitable food scraps to reduce environmental impact.
  9. Regular Appliance Maintenance:
    • Clean and maintain kitchen appliances according to the manufacturer’s instructions.
    • Inspect seals on refrigerators and freezers to ensure they are intact and functioning.
  10. Stay Informed:
    • Keep abreast of food safety updates and recalls.
    • Follow reputable sources for the latest information on foodborne illnesses.

Implementing these tips in your home kitchen not only promotes food safety but also sets a positive example for family members. By fostering a culture of hygiene and responsibility, you contribute to a healthier and happier living environment.
